Eclipse插件nWire 1.0發(fā)布 極大方便代碼閱讀
Eclipse插件nWire 1.0發(fā)布。nWire可以幫助Java開發(fā)者更清晰的閱讀代碼,提高編程效率。通常程序員分析代碼所花費的時間比編寫代碼更長,通過集中查看程序組件和相互關聯(lián),再加上獨特的搜索和可視化工具,可以使編程效率大大提高。
現(xiàn)代Java程序都依附于標準架構和設計模式。nWire提供了一個獨特的視角,通過它可以知道一個組件(比如類或接口)是如何插入到工程架構中的,并可以知道其依賴關系從而避免bug出現(xiàn)。nWire讓初學者學習Java變得簡單;可以讓程序員更輕松的修改別人編寫的代碼;而且非常適合進行軟件外包開發(fā)。
nWire提供了一些特有的工具:
◆nWire Navigator——一個用來瀏覽程序代碼中各種形式的關聯(lián)(association)的工具:包括類型繼承、接口實現(xiàn)、方法調(diào)用等
◆nWire QuickSearch—可用來搜索系統(tǒng)中的各種元素,包括方法和字段
◆nWire Visualizer——圖形化顯示系統(tǒng)元素,并將它們之間的關聯(lián)表示出來
nWire支持帶JDT的Eclipse 3.4和3.3。支持Windows XP/Vista,Mac OS X和Linux平臺。
nWire Software公司是一個獨立的軟件供應商,專注于開發(fā)Eclipse平臺下的軟件開發(fā)工具。nWire Software希望能通過向用戶提供簡單實用的工具來幫助他們提高開發(fā)效率。nWire Software公司于2007年建立,總部在以色列的特拉維夫。
相關閱讀
nWire是為軟件工程師提供的一個Eclipse插件,它為代碼探測提供了創(chuàng)新的方法。它的核心是建立一個知識
庫,保存所有可能的組件(如類,方法)和聯(lián)系(如擴展,調(diào)用),同時提供便利的工具,用來瀏覽、搜索和
查看知識庫。最初版本支持Java的靜態(tài)代碼分析,我計劃著將它擴展到流行框架(如JEE, Spring)以及其他的
編程語言。
【編輯推薦】















 
 
 
 
 
 
 